/*
|
||||
* Register handlers.
|
||||
* We store the position of a register field inside a field structure,
|
||||
* This will simplify the process of setting and reading a certain field
|
||||
* inside the register while making sure the process remains byte order safe.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
struct rt2x00_field8 {
|
||||
u8 bit_offset;
|
||||
u8 bit_mask;
|
||||
};
|
||||
|
||||
struct rt2x00_field16 {
|
||||
u16 bit_offset;
|
||||
u16 bit_mask;
|
||||
};
|
||||
|
||||
struct rt2x00_field32 {
|
||||
u32 bit_offset;
|
||||
u32 bit_mask;
|
||||
};
|
||||
|
||||
/*
|
||||
* Power of two check, this will check
|
||||
* if the mask that has been given contains and contiguous set of bits.
|
||||
* Note that we cannot use the is_power_of_2() function since this
|
||||
* check must be done at compile-time.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
#define is_power_of_two(x) ( !((x) & ((x)-1)) )
|
||||
#define low_bit_mask(x) ( ((x)-1) & ~(x) )
|
||||
#define is_valid_mask(x) is_power_of_two(1LU + (x) + low_bit_mask(x))

/*
|
||||
* Macros to find first set bit in a variable.
|
||||
* These macros behave the same as the __ffs() functions but
|
||||
* the most important difference that this is done during
|
||||
* compile-time rather then run-time.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
#define compile_ffs2(__x) \
|
||||
__builtin_choose_expr(((__x) & 0x1), 0, 1)
|
||||
|
||||
#define compile_ffs4(__x) \
|
||||
__builtin_choose_expr(((__x) & 0x3), \
|
||||
(compile_ffs2((__x))), \
|
||||
(compile_ffs2((__x) >> 2) + 2))
|
||||
|
||||
#define compile_ffs8(__x) \
|
||||
__builtin_choose_expr(((__x) & 0xf), \
|
||||
(compile_ffs4((__x))), \
|
||||
(compile_ffs4((__x) >> 4) + 4))
|
||||
|
||||
#define compile_ffs16(__x) \
|
||||
__builtin_choose_expr(((__x) & 0xff), \
|
||||
(compile_ffs8((__x))), \
|
||||
(compile_ffs8((__x) >> 8) + 8))
|
||||
|
||||
#define compile_ffs32(__x) \
|
||||
__builtin_choose_expr(((__x) & 0xffff), \
|
||||
(compile_ffs16((__x))), \
|
||||
(compile_ffs16((__x) >> 16) + 16))
